#include <iostream>
|
|
#include <Context.h>
|
|
#include <test.h>
|
|
|
|
Context context;
|
|
|
|
////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
|
|
int main (int argc, char** argv)
|
|
{
|
|
UnitTest t (11);
|
|
|
|
Config c;
|
|
|
|
// void set (const std::string&, const std::string&);
|
|
// const std::string get (const std::string&);
|
|
c.set ("str1", "one");
|
|
t.is (c.get ("str1"), "one", "Config::set/get std::string");
|
|
|
|
c.set ("str1", "");
|
|
t.is (c.get ("str1"), "", "Config::set/get std::string");
|
|
|
|
// void set (const std::string&, const int);
|
|
// const int getInteger (const std::string&);
|
|
c.set ("int1", 1);
|
|
t.is (c.getInteger ("int1"), 1, "Config::set/get int");
|
|
|
|
c.set ("int2", 3);
|
|
t.is (c.getInteger ("int2"), 3, "Config::set/get int");
|
|
|
|
c.set ("int3", -9);
|
|
t.is (c.getInteger ("int3"), -9, "Config::set/get int");
|
|
|
|
// void set (const std::string&, const double);
|
|
// const double getReal (const std::string&);
|
|
c.set ("double1", 1.0);
|
|
t.is (c.getReal ("double1"), 1.0, "Config::set/get double");
|
|
|
|
c.set ("double2", 3.0);
|
|
t.is (c.getReal ("double2"), 3.0, "Config::set/get double");
|
|
|
|
c.set ("double3", -9.0);
|
|
t.is (c.getReal ("double3"), -9.0, "Config::set/get double");
|
|
|
|
// void set (const std::string&, const bool);
|
|
// const bool getBoolean (const std::string&);
|
|
c.set ("bool1", false);
|
|
t.is (c.getBoolean ("bool1"), false, "Config::set/get bool");
|
|
|
|
c.set ("bool1", true);
|
|
t.is (c.getBoolean ("bool1"), true, "Config::set/get bool");
|
|
|
|
// void all (std::vector <std::string>&);
|
|
std::vector <std::string> all;
|
|
c.all (all);
|
|
|
|
// 8 created in this test program.
|
|
// 22 default report setting created in Config::Config.
|
|
t.ok (all.size () >= 8, "Config::all");
|
|
|
|
// TODO Test includes
|
|
// TODO Test included nesting limit
|
|
// TODO Test included absolute vs relative
|
|
// TODO Test included missing file
|
|
|
|
return 0;
|
|
}
